LOS ANGELES, Feb 8 — Antonio Banderas, Michael Sheen, Emma Thompson, Ralph Fiennes, Tom Holland and Selena Gomez have joined the cast of The Voyage of Doctor Dolittle, reports Deadline. They join Robert Downey Jr, signed up to the leading role almost a year ago.

The Voyage of Doctor Dolittle will be the latest movie adaptation of the children's books written by British author Hugh Lofting, published from the 1920s onwards. The original story, set in Victorian England, follows John Little, a country doctor who can talk to animals.

The adventures of John Dolittle have been brought to the big screen on several occasions. Rex Harrison played the character in the 1967 Doctor Dolittle musical directed by Richard Fleischer. The character was also made popular in the 2000s by Eddie Murphy.

For this latest adaptation — due in theatres April 2019 — Robert Downey Jr takes over as Doctor Dolittle. The actor, who plays superhero Iron Man, will be joined by Antonio Banderas as a pirate named Rassouli and Michael Sheen as Mudfly. Emma Thompson (Beauty and the Beast), Ralph Fiennes — who played Lord Voldemort in the Harry Potter movies — Tom Holland (Spider-Man: Homecoming) and Selena Gomez will voice different animals.

The movie is due to start filming at the end of this month in London and is directed by Stephen Gaghan, who previously directed Syriana and wrote the screenplay for Traffic. The film is slated for release in US theatres April 12, 2019.
